NvEncoder NvDecoder DMA

Technical question for NVidia team :

Do Encoder and Decoder have their own DMA to transfer data between RAM and VRAM or do they take bandwith with all other memory transfers ?

Both are true. Could you tell us the motivation for the question, so that we can answer correctly?

As you can imagine, it’s related to my other question : https://devtalk.nvidia.com/default/topic/1020675/video-technologies/nvenc-nvdec-keep-compressed-data-on-gpu-to-direct-decode-/

My motivations are to avoid readback (for now impossible) and minimize/avoid impact of encode/decode on other work I’m doing.